Grief can manifest differently in children compared to adults, making it crucial for caregivers to recognize and understand these differences, especially following cremation services in Taneytown, MD. Younger children may not fully grasp the concept of death and might express their grief through changes in behavior, play, or mood swings. It is essential for adults to monitor these signs and provide a supportive environment where children feel safe to express their feelings openly and honestly.


Communicating About Loss


One of the most vital steps in helping children cope with the loss after a cremation is open and honest communication. Children need clear, age-appropriate explanations about what has happened. Avoiding euphemisms like "sleeping" or "gone away" is important, as these can create confusion or fear. Encouraging questions and providing comforting, truthful answers help children process the situation and feel more secure.


Therapeutic Activities for Expression


Engaging children in activities can be a practical way to help them express their feelings. Art, music, writing, or physical activities can be therapeutic. Art projects related to memories of the loved one, such as drawing pictures or making a scrapbook, can be particularly helpful. These activities provide a tangible way for children to remember the deceased and express feelings they might not yet have the words to convey.


The Role of Routines in Healing


Maintaining routines is crucial for children's coping and sense of stability after a loss. Regular schedules provide a framework of normalcy amidst the confusion of grief. While some flexibility is necessary, keeping to routines in daily life helps children feel secure and understand that life will continue, even after significant changes.


Support Systems for Grieving Children


A strong support system is essential for children coping with grief. This can include family members, friends, teachers, and counselors. Professional help from a child psychologist or a grief counselor who specializes in children's grief can be invaluable in providing coping strategies tailored to individual needs. Schools and community centers often have resources and support groups for grieving children, which can also be a significant aid.


Commemorative Practices and Memorials


Creating a ritual or having a physical place to remember the deceased can offer comfort to grieving children. Whether it's visiting a place that was special to the loved one or creating a memorial at home, these practices allow children to connect with their memories and emotions in a healthy, controlled manner. It reinforces that it’s okay to remember and celebrate the life of the one they have lost.


Building Resilience Through Ongoing Support


Building resilience in children is a long-term process that involves ongoing support and reassurance. It’s important to recognize milestones in their grieving process and continue providing support as they adjust over time. Celebrating their strength in facing grief and encouraging open discussions about feelings and memories can empower children to manage their emotions effectively.
